当前位置: 首页 > news >正文

53、Linux 系统优化与命令行操作指南

Linux 系统优化与命令行操作指南

1. MySQL 优化建议

在处理 MySQL 数据库时,为了提升性能和效率,有一些实用的优化建议:
-字段声明:创建表时,将字段声明为NOT NULL,这样可以节省空间并提高查询速度。
-默认值设置:为字段提供默认值,并在合适的地方使用它们。
-表连接操作:表连接操作容易导致低效查询,使用时需格外谨慎。若必须使用连接,要确保在索引字段上进行连接,并且优先选择整数类型的字段,因为整数比较比字符串更快。
-慢查询处理:查找并修复慢查询。可以在/etc/my.cnf文件的[mysqld]部分添加log-long-formatlog-slow-queries = /var/log/slow-queries.log,MySQL 会记录执行时间较长的查询。
-表碎片整理:使用OPTIMIZE TABLE tablename命令对表进行碎片整理并刷新索引。

2. 为何使用命令行

虽然图形用户界面(GUI)在日常任务中能让操作更便捷,但命令行在 Linux 系统中仍具有不可替代的优势:
-命令组合:可以将多个命令组合在一起,创造出数百种新的命令

http://www.jsqmd.com/news/88330/

相关文章:

  • Cameralink采集卡软件EspeedGrab使用讲解:3 保存采集参数
  • C#+VisionMaster 学习笔记(目录)-目录
  • 54、Linux命令行与软件管理全攻略
  • MySQL数据处理(增删改)
  • 电科毕设 stm32 wifi远程可视化与农业灌溉系统(源码+硬件+论文)
  • 55、Ubuntu 系统软件管理全攻略
  • 34、Bash脚本中的循环控制与故障排查
  • 2025年年终无人机吊运公司推荐:不同预算与项目规模下的性价比分析与5家服务商对比 - 品牌推荐
  • vue基于Spring Boot框架的在线音乐推荐排行榜网站_q46lgu0x
  • 摄影的光线运用
  • 56、Linux内核与模块管理全解析
  • 英语_阅读_CIMON 2_待读
  • 35、脚本开发中的故障排除、流程控制与参数处理
  • 一文搞懂CNN - LSTM - Attention回归预测:新手友好实战
  • 如何选择靠谱的无人机吊运服务商?2025年年终最新市场深度解析及5家实力公司推荐! - 品牌推荐
  • vue基于Spring Boot框架的学生干部选举管理系统的设计与实现_4q46dzc1
  • 26、GNOME开发中的实用组件与功能详解
  • Kubernetes Node 管理完全指南:从入门到生产实践
  • 27、GNOME开发:Druids、会话管理及Glade使用指南
  • Cameralink采集卡软件EspeedGrab使用讲解:4图像处理
  • Kubernetes RBAC 权限控制实战指南:从零开始掌握每个细节
  • 36、脚本编程中的参数、循环与数据处理
  • const引用
  • vue基于Spring Boot框架的小型企业薪资绩效工资评估管理系统的设计与实现_311837nn
  • Comsol仿真:相场法多晶铁电体介电击穿模拟全解析
  • 27、Unix 系统下的文档格式化与打印指南
  • vue基于Spring Boot框架的新生入学报道管理系统_j956n3k5
  • 光伏MPPT仿真-固定电压法+扰动观察法+电导增量法 模型版本:有两个版本2015a和2022...
  • 台达DVPES2系列PLC与欧姆龙E5CC温控器通讯实现温控
  • 【思维模型】第一性原理 ③ ( 5 Why 分析法 | 明确问题 | 层层深入 | 验证原因 | 改进措施 )